About me


I am Lucas Cherini, a Master Builder and an advanced Mechanical Engineering student.

Previously, I worked in construction as a Master Builder, where I provided consulting, project management, supervision, and construction of residential works, as well as electrical, plumbing, and gas installations.

Additionally, I worked in the manufacturing industry as a Methods and Time Analyst. There, I was responsible for the development, control, and optimization of the manufacturing processes for the Alcatel ONE TOUCH production lines, and I also assisted with the Motorola, Noblex, Lenovo, and Sony lines.

During my studies, I worked at the Aerospace Technology Center in the piping area, where, alongside VENG and CONAE, we developed the new rocket engine test stand for the Tronador II project.

Currently, I am working at Solaer Ingenieria as a Computational Structural Engineer, where I designed and validated advanced FEM models for mechanical structures, optimizing performance and reducing material costs. I also conducted detailed structural analysis in compliance with ASME, API, CIRSOC standards, ensuring regulatory approval and operational safety, and I created engineering reports and technical documentation for design validation and project certification.

I have extensive experience in design and simulation with Abaqus, Catia, SolidWorks, AutoCAD, MatLab, C, Python, and Arduino.
